COLE’S GOES HUGE
GRAND RAPIDS, January 1, 2008 – Cole’s Quality Foods began its sponsorship on the HUGE show. The HUGE show is a sports/talk radio network show that airs weekday afternoons from 3:00 pm to 6:00 pm on WBBL 1340 am across the state of Michigan and on Sundays from 6:00 pm to 9:00 pm on nationally syndicated radio stations. During the HUGE show, Cole’s will sponsor the “Cole’s Quality Call of the Day”. Bill Simonson takes more phone calls and opinions daily than most radio hosts take in a week. Sponsoring this part of the show will allow for a seamless integration into the fabric of this very popular radio show and allow Cole’s daily exposure to the HUGE shows’ loyal listening audience.
About Cole's
Founded in 1943, Cole’s Quality Foods is a privately-held, Michigan-based category leader in frozen bakery products. In 1972, Cole’s invented the first frozen garlic bread and created a category that generates more than $300 million in sales annually. Today, the Company produces a complete line of frozen garlic breads, garlic toasts, garlic breadsticks, Cheesesticks and Pizzasticks. Cole’s is an opportunity driven and adaptable organization that provides “WOW” products. The company employs more than 200 people in Muskegon and Grand Rapids, Michigan and in North Liberty, Iowa.
